適切なプロキシの選択:ネットと電流
漁師が獲物に適した網を選ぶように、代理指標の選択は非常に重要です。代理指標には主に3つの種類があります。
プロキシタイプ | スピード | 匿名 | 信頼性 | 使用事例 |
---|---|---|---|---|
公開(無料) | 変数 | 低い | 低い | カジュアルブラウジング、スクレイピング |
プライベート(有料) | 高い | 高い | 高い | ビジネス、安全なタスク |
回転 | 中/高 | 高い | 中/高 | ウェブスクレイピング、自動化 |
リソース: 新鮮なプロキシが満載のネットについては、 プロキシローラーは、無料プロキシの最大級の選択肢を提供しています。
代理を集める:網を投げる
- 訪問 プロキシローラー.
- 希望するプロキシ タイプ (HTTP、HTTPS、SOCKS4、SOCKS5) を選択します。
- プロキシ リストをテキストまたは CSV 形式でダウンロードします。
プロキシリストの形式の例:
123.45.67.89:8080
98.76.54.32:3128
...
サーバーなしのマルチプロキシ設定:アイランドホッピング
島民が中央の港を持たずに環礁から環礁へと移動するのと同じように、中央サーバーを必要とせずに、複数のプロキシを経由してトラフィックをローカルにルーティングできます。これは、ローカルプロキシ管理ツールとスマートなブラウザ/ネットワーク設定によって実現できます。
1. プロキシスイッチャー拡張機能の使用(ブラウザレベル)
最適な用途: ブラウジング、軽量使用。
- 拡張機能:
- フォクシープロキシ (Firefox/Chrome)
- プロキシスイッチyOmega (クロム)
セットアップ手順:
1. 拡張機能をインストールします。
2. ProxyRoller からプロキシをインポートします。
3. 各エンドポイントのプロキシ プロファイルを定義します。
4. 手動で切り替えるか、ローテーションルールを設定します。
FoxyProxy サンプルプロファイル:
{
"title": "ProxyRoller_1",
"proxyType": "manual",
"httpProxy": "123.45.67.89",
"httpProxyPort": 8080,
"socksProxy": "",
"socksProxyPort": 0
}
2. ローカルプロキシローテーター(自動化、システム全体)
魚を誘導するサンゴ礁の流れのように、ローカル ローテーターは一連のプロキシを通じてトラフィックを誘導します。
オープンソースツール:
プロキシチェーンの設定:
- Proxychains をインストールします。
bash
sudo apt-get install proxychains - 編集
/etc/proxychains.conf
:
一番下に、ProxyRoller からのプロキシをリストします。
[ProxyList]
http 123.45.67.89 8080
http 98.76.54.32 3128 - チェーンタイプ:
dynamic_chain
ドーニが砂州をスキップするように、Proxychains が無効なプロキシをスキップできるようにします。
dynamic_chain
- プロキシチェーンを介してアプリケーションを実行する:
bash
proxychains firefox
Proxychains は、各接続に対してリスト内の最初の動作中のプロキシの使用を試みます。
3. カスタム プロキシ ローテーター スクリプト (Python の例)
独自の進路を計画する人にとって、スクリプトは熟練したナビゲーターと同様の柔軟性を提供します。
import requests
proxies = [
'http://123.45.67.89:8080',
'http://98.76.54.32:3128',
# Add more from ProxyRoller
]
def cycle_proxies(url):
for proxy in proxies:
try:
response = requests.get(url, proxies={'http': proxy, 'https': proxy}, timeout=5)
print(f'Using {proxy}: {response.status_code}')
except Exception as e:
print(f'Proxy {proxy} failed: {e}')
cycle_proxies('http://example.com')
リソース: プロキシ文書の要求
4. システム全体のプロキシ管理(ネットワークレベル)
すべての送信接続が同じ電流に乗るように、プロキシを直接使用するように OS を構成します。
ウィンドウズ:
- 手動セットアップ:
- コントロール パネル > インターネット オプション > 接続 > LAN の設定 > プロキシ サーバーを使用する。
macOS:
- 手動セットアップ:
- システム環境設定 > ネットワーク > 詳細 > プロキシ。
注意: これらのメソッドはローテーションをサポートしていません。ローテーションには、Proxifier または Proxychains を使用してください。
表: ツールの比較
道具 | OSサポート | 回転 | オートメーション | GUI | 使用事例 |
---|---|---|---|---|---|
フォクシープロキシ | Windows/Mac/Linux | マニュアル | いいえ | はい | ブラウジング |
プロキシチェーン | Linux/Mac | はい | はい | いいえ | CLIアプリ |
プロキシファイア | Windows/Mac | はい | はい | はい | システム全体 |
プロキシブローカー | すべて(Python) | はい | はい | いいえ | スクリプト/自動化 |
スムーズな航海のためのヒント
- プロキシの鮮度: プロキシリストを定期的に更新する プロキシローラー パブリックプロキシは利用できなくなることが多いためです。
- 地理的選択: 地域固有のアクセスの場合は、希望する国のプロキシを選択します (ProxyRoller はフィルタリングを提供します)。
- テストプロキシ: 次のようなツールを使用する プロキシチェッカー 信頼性を確保するため。
- レート制限を尊重する: ブロックされたりブラックリストに登録されたりしないようにプロキシをローテーションします。これは、単一のサンゴ礁で魚を過剰に捕獲しないのと同じです。
リソースと参考文献
- ProxyRoller 無料プロキシ
- プロキシチェーン GitHub
- FoxyProxy ヘルプ
- プロキシスイッチyOmegaガイド
- Python リクエストプロキシ
- ProxyNova プロキシチェッカー
中央サーバーなしでデジタルの海を航海することは、島の知恵による行為です。つまり、多くの小さな船を信頼し、それぞれが荷物の一部を運び、すべての人にとっての回復力と豊かさを確保するのです。
コメント (0)
まだコメントはありません。あなたが最初のコメントを投稿できます!